CHICAGO — The Philadelphia Phillies used an opener and altered up their batting order Wednesday, however neither transfer did the trick, as they dropped their eighth consecutive sport, losing 7-2 to the Chicago Cubs. The eight straight losses are the staff’s most since a nine-game skid in 2018.

“Just not going our way right now,” pitcher Taijuan Walker stated afterward. “We’re not executing. Just kind of in a rut. When you get in these ruts, it’s hard to get out of sometimes. And right now we’re just not getting out of it.”

Walker was the majority pitcher Wednesday after left-hander Kyle Backhus pitched the primary inning, giving up a run on two hits. Walker did not fare a lot better, giving up 5 runs, though solely 4 had been earned.

The Phillies had been main 2-1 in the second inning when a misplayed ball in heart by Justin Crawford and second baseman Edmundo Sosa allowed the Cubs to tie the rating. Philadelphia by no means recaptured the lead — or scored once more.

“[Crawford] called it too early and got Sosa out of there and really that’s Sosa’s ball,” supervisor Rob Thomson stated. “And I think that just comes with experience, playing in this ballpark with the wind and you got to really make sure that you get there.”

The play was emblematic of the Phillies’ latest woes, which had been outdone solely by the New York Metswho snapped their very own 12-game dropping skid Wednesday. Now it is Philadelphia that owns the longest present dropping streak in MLB.

“Yeah, it sucks,” shortstop Trea Turner he stated. “Not having much fun in here, which is tough. This is a great game. We’re lucky to play it. And when you are expected to win and you want to win and it’s not happening, it’s tough and not fun, but that’s why we’re here.”

The Phillies managed 9 hits however did not earn a stroll whereas placing out 12 instances in dropping their third sport of the collection. The meek offensive output resembled a number of different video games this season when opposed by a left-handed starter. Matthew Boyd was the most recent to close down the Phillies’ offense. He gave up two runs whereas three Cubs relievers pitched a shutout the remainder of the way in which. The Phillies are 0-9 this season when a lefty begins in opposition to them (excluding openers).

“They throw a lot of strikes,” Thomson stated. “Usually one of our strong suits is walking and putting balls in play and hitting home runs and chewing up pitches.”

Turner added: “I feel like we get one guy on base and then he kind of dies for whatever reason. And that’s just not good enough. So maybe it’s a little bit of approach.”

The Phillies (and Mets) are already 8½ video games out of first place in the National League East as the Atlanta Braves have gotten off to a quick begin. That’s not the case for final yr’s division winner, which is looking for early-season solutions.

The Phillies should not discovering something proper now.

“Baseball’s a long season and we got a long way to go,” Thomson stated. “And I think there’s a lot of frustration here. But at the same time, these guys know that we got a talented group. Not much is going right for us right now. And at times we’re not playing well. So we just got to stay after it and keep fighting. I mean, this is a talented group.”
